(YMMV) American Express No Longer Uses Expedited Shipping For New Credit Card Approvals

I’ve applied for a number of American Express cards over the years and was always impressed with the speed they got the card in my hand. Often I’d get the card early the next morning at my doorstep. 

My recent card approval for the AmEx Business Gold card seemed like an outlier – it took more than a week from time of approval via reconsideration until I received the card. My thinking was that only the automated AmEx system has the expedited shipping built into the workflow, not for approvals via reconsideration. 

I’m seeing now a bunch of Reddit users report that recently they’re getting slow card shipping on their new AmEx approvals. Many seems to be for the Platinum card mirror finish – perhaps it takes longer to get that card finish created.

Others report, more generally, that AmEx has removed expedited shipping from the Gold and other mid-tier cards, and that even requesting expedited shipping won’t help.

It’s worth noting that American Express is pretty good about giving an instantly issued card number upon approval, and you can start using that immediately online, and can add to your digital wallet for in-store purchases.
